Overview

JK5G is a postbiotic formulation developed to modulate the gut microbiota and improve outcomes in patients with advanced non-small-cell lung cancer (NSCLC) receiving immune checkpoint inhibitors (ICIs). In clinical studies, administration of JK5G alongside PD-1 inhibitor-based immunotherapy and chemotherapy was associated with reduced incidence of immune-related adverse events (irAEs), improved quality of life, better nutritional status, and amelioration of tumor microenvironment inflammation. The mechanism is believed to involve modulation of the intestinal microbiome, which in turn influences systemic immunity and response to cancer immunotherapy. Clinical trials have demonstrated that patients receiving JK5G had lower rates of anemia, decreased lymphocyte count, appetite loss, nausea, asthenia, and other adverse effects compared to controls[1][2][6].
